Wipro makes another buy-out within a week – mPower
The ink had barely dried on Monday's $56 million purchase of Austria-based NewLogic, when on Thursday it acquired New Jersey-based mPower for an all-cash payout of $28 million.
mPower, a company focused on payment space, owns a development center in Chennai and boasts total annual revenue of around $18 million. Through this acquisition, Wipro adds on a 300-member-strong team and domain expertise in the payment space, which will enable it to expand its market in the financial solutions business. "As a part of this agreement, Wipro will provide MasterCard and other clients in the payment space with a wide range of services that could include Application Development and Maintenance, Infrastructure Services, Package Implementation, BPO and Testing," adds a company press release.
Ashish Thadhani, an analyst with Gilford Securities said: "From an operational standpoint, this will expand Wipro's domain expertise in the financial services vertical, which is growing at 50 percent year-over-year in eight of the last nine quarters."
